EDITORS COMMENTS
In this electrifying moment captured at Craven Cottage on March 4,2006, Thierry Henry etches his name into Arsenal folklore by scoring the team's first goal in a dominating 4-0 victory over Fulham in the FA Premiership. With Moritz Volz of Fulham hot on his heels, Henry demonstrates his world-class finishing ability, expertly placing the ball past the outstretched arms of Fulham goalkeeper, Antti Niemi. The goal came in the 21st minute of the match and marked the beginning of an impressive second half of the 2005-2006 season for Arsenal. Henry's strike boosted the team's morale and set the tone for the remaining games, ultimately contributing to their eventual third place finish in the league. Henry's goal was a testament to his unwavering determination and skill, showcasing his ability to thrive under pressure. The French international striker's performance on the day was a reminder of why he was considered one of the best players in the world at the time. The atmosphere at Craven Cottage was electric as Arsenal's fans reveled in their team's dominance. The goal served as a turning point in the match, with Arsenal going on to score three more goals before the final whistle. This iconic image encapsulates the passion, intensity, and brilliance of Thierry Henry and Arsenal Football Club during a memorable season.
